United Kingdom
Income, other than a pension, paid from the public funds of the United Kingdom,
its political subdivisions, or local authorities to an individua for services
performed for the paying governmental body is exempt from U.S. income tax.
However, the exemption does not apply if the services are performed in the
United States by a resident of the United States who either:
� Is a U.S. citizen, or
� Did not become a U.S. resident only to perform the services.
Pensions paid by, or funds created by, the United Kingdom, its political
subdivisions, or local authorities for services performed for the United Kingdom
are exempt from U.S. income tax unless the recipient is both a resident and
citizen of the United States.
These exemptions do not apply to income or pensions for services performed in
connection with a business carried on by the United Kingdom, its political
subdivisions, or local authorities.
